You introduced the choice element in Teiid 8.2 which 

The implementation of the "choice" between a generic/non-standard <sequence> and an <element>. Looking at it from an XML-only standpoint, you've created a scenario where a user would either enter 1-8 elements, or 1 element which may seem OK, but not from a schema standpoint. And JAXB constructs (annotations) can't handle it.

The simple fix/minimal change would to convert <allow-language> to an attribute and remove the choice. There has been no Teiid Designer support for editing <allow-language> prior to our upcoming 8.2 release. So any users would be hand-editing the vdb.xml anyway to utilize that option.

I wouldn't try to be backward compatible in this case.

> Having a lot of trouble trying to tweak our JaxB VDB element classes to accommodate the permission's choice node which contains a <sequence> and an <element>.
> This structure is basically impossible to unmarshall using JAXB annotations (i.e. @XmlElements(value= {}) )
> Would clean things up to convert the <allow-language> element to an attribute:  <xs:attribute name="allow-language" type="xs:boolean"/> and place it on the <permission> element AND remove the <choice> node entirely
